Access to these services from the WAN interface can be restricted through the use of the packet filtering feature of the device. The packet filtering feature contains a vulnerability that could allow a remote attacker to successfully connect to one of these services by specifying a source port of 53/udp. Affected Products: Symantec Firewall/VPN Appliance 100 (firmware builds prior to build 1.63)\nSymantec Firewall/VPN Appliance 200/200R (firmware builds prior to build 1.63)\nSymantec Gateway Security 320 (firmware builds prior to build 622)\nSymantec Gateway Security 360/360R (firmware builds prior to build 622)","impact":"A remote, unauthenticated attacker may be able to establish connections to services in violation of security policies. As a result, an attacker could send packets to these services that are configured to be unreachable from the WAN interface. An attacker could also leverage this flaw to exploit a vulnerability in one of these services. For instance, there is a vulnerability in the Firewall/VPN and Gateway Security appliances that allows a remote attacker to read and modify any SNMP object present on an affected device (VU#173910).","resolution":"Upgrade Firmware\nAccording to the Symantec Advisory, product specific firmware and hotfixes are available via the Symantec Enterprise Support site. http://www.symantec.com/techsupp/","workarounds":"","sysaffected":"","thanks":"This vulnerability was reported by Symantec.
